Color Pairing Ideas Worth Considering

Sage green nails shine best when paired thoughtfully. Neutral tones like soft beiges, gentle greys, and creamy whites create a calm, chic ensemble. Milky whites especially make sage pop while keeping things serene.

Soft pinks are another fantastic companion for sage green, adding a blush of femininity without overpowering the quiet coolness of the shade. Nude palettes with hints of peach or caramel warm up the sage for a more grounded, everyday look.

For those days when you crave contrast, bolder hues like deep red or burgundy create drama and elegance. Imagine sage green with just one bold burgundy accent nail: it’s a little surprise for your mani.

Chrome finishes, when teamed with sage, transform the look into something futuristic and fashion forward. If you love shiny glazed effects, try layering a translucent gloss over your sage nails for that wet, fresh-picked feel.

Pastel shades like soft lavender, baby blue, or even pale yellow bring playful energy to sage green, perfect for spring or summer vibes. Pairing seasonally, sage and warm rusts or burnt oranges can make your nails feel autumn ready, while icy blues blend beautifully for a winter-inspired manicure.

Frequently Asked Questions

How durable are sage green nail polishes?

Durability depends on the polish type. Gel and shellac options tend to last longer without chipping, while standard polishes may need regular touch-ups. Always use a quality base and topcoat for best results.

What nail shape complements sage green nails most?

Sage green works beautifully on many shapes including oval, almond, squoval, and coffin. The color is versatile enough to suit both short and long lengths, so choose the shape that fits your lifestyle.

Can sage green nails be worn year-round?

Absolutely! Sage green transitions nicely through all seasons. Pair it with light shades for spring and summer or with earth tones and metallics for fall and winter looks.

How should I describe my desired design to the salon?

Be specific about nail shape, length, and finish. Mention if you want matte, glossy, chrome, or glitter. If you prefer accents or nail art, bringing photos always helps communicate exactly what you want.

Are there any special nail products to help maintain sage green nails?

Using a good topcoat extends wear and enhances shine or matte effects. Cuticle oils and hand moisturizers also keep your nails looking healthy and prevent polish from lifting.

Can I wear sage green nails for everyday activities?

Definitely! Many sage green shades are subtle enough for daily wear and professional settings while still feeling stylish and modern.

What if I grow out my natural nails with sage green gel polish?

Regular fills every two to three weeks keep gel nails looking neat. As they grow, you can update designs or switch colors without refiling the entire nail each time.
